Ok Now I got it work. Required some try and error methods. Here's the working script with some other additions.

Code: Select all

local debug = "1" -- Debug on = 1, off = 0
COPidx = otherdevices_idx['Heatpump COP']
commandArray = {}
time = os.date("*t")
if((time.min % 2)==0)then --Run every 2 minutes
	if otherdevices['Heatpump Mode'] == "Heat" then
		OutletTemp = otherdevices_svalues['Heatpump Outlet Temp']
		InletTemp = otherdevices_svalues['Heatpump Inlet Temp']
		inpower, energy = otherdevices_svalues['Heatpump Power/Energy']:match("([^;]+)")	
		var1 = otherdevices['Heatpump Fan Speed']
			if var1 == "Auto" then
				airvolume = 0  --If fan is in Auto mode, air flow could not be determined
			elseif var1 == "1" then
				airvolume = 406.80  --Fan speed 1 means 406.80m3/h air flow
			elseif var1 == "2" then
				airvolume = 475.80  --Fan speed 1 means 475.80m3/h air flow
			elseif var1 == "3" then
				airvolume = 684.60  --Fan speed 1 means 684.60m3/h air flow
			elseif var1 == "4" then
				airvolume = 900.00  --Fan speed 1 means 900.00m3/h air flow
			elseif var1 == "5" then
				airvolume = 954.60  --Fan speed 1 means 954.60m3/h air flow
			else
				print("####Ivalid FAN Speed") --If fan speed could not be read it is invalid and program terminated
				return 
			end
		inpowercompare = tonumber(string.format("%." .. (2) .. "f", inpower))
		if inpowercompare > 165 then --Panasonic minimum input power in Heat mode
			outpower = (OutletTemp-InletTemp)*airvolume*0.94*1.293*1.01--Assume that there is 6% error in air volume(0.96), 1.293 constant air density, 1.01 specific heat capacity for air
			outpowercompare = tonumber(string.format("%." .. (2) .. "f", outpower))
			if outpower > 0 then 
				rawcop = outpower/(inpower/1000*3600) --inpower*3600, power consumption in hour
				cop = tonumber(string.format("%." .. (2) .. "f", rawcop))
			else
				print( "####Outpower negative, Heapump de-ice?...")
				return
			end
		else
			print( "####Inpower too low, Heapump COP calculation not updated...")
			return 
		end
		if (debug == "1") then
			print( " ####Fan read: "..var1)
			print( " ####Airvolume: "..airvolume)
			print( " ####Outlet temp: "..OutletTemp)
			print( " ####Inlet temp: "..InletTemp)
			print( " ####Power: "..inpower)
			print( " ####Outpower: "..outpower)
			print( " ####Raw Cop calculation: "..rawcop)
			print( " ####Cop: "..cop)
		end
		if cop < 12 then
			if cop > -0.01 then
				commandArray['UpdateDevice'] = COPidx..'|0|'..cop
				print( "####Heatpump COP updated")
			else
				print ( "####COP too low, Heapump COP calculation not updated...")
			end
		else
			print( "####COP too high, Heapump COP calculation not updated...")
		end
	else
		print( "####Heatpump not in Heat mode...")
	end
end
return commandArray
